I've led marketing teams for 20 years and I hate to break it to you but:
Your Substack subscribers want what every corporate stakeholder wants. Clarity. Predictability. Proof you can deliver.
I figured this out after my third paid post bombed.
I'd been writing the way most newsletter writers write. Loose. Inspired. Whatever felt right that week.
Then one Tuesday I caught myself drafting a paid post the way I'd draft a quarterly update for my board: clear promise, structured proof, specific deliverable, predictable cadence.
That post drove 11 paid conversions.
Your paid subscribers are stakeholders. Write like it.
